Five whys (or 5 whys) is an iterative interrogative technique used to explore the cause-and-effect relationships underlying a particular problem. [1] The primary goal of the technique is to determine the root cause of a defect or problem by repeating the question "why?"

[4] The technique splits classes into mixed groups to work on small problems that the group collates into an outcome. [1] For example, an in-class assignment is divided into topics. Students are then split into groups with one member assigned to each topic.
Plastic platypus learning in action. A related method is the plastic platypus learning or platypus learning technique. This technique is based on evidence that show that teaching an inanimate object improves understanding and knowledge retention of a subject.
